Cassie Valentine had a good feeling about this year. Freshman year of college hadn’t gone exactly according to plan, but that was okay. 

Everyone told her college was supposed to be a learning experience. Well, she had learnt that living in a dorm was not for her and neither was dating casually or having one-night stands.

It’s not that she was opposed to dating, but sometimes the ritual was more exhausting than exhilarating. She had to accept the fact that she was one of those girls that was meant to be in a meaningful relationship.

Besides, Valentines were romantics, never settling until they met their soulmate. Then, they were mated for life and that was that.

“Hey, don’t wander off too far,” she heard her twin brother Max say as they entered the college bookstore. “I’m on the three to nine today, so will only have time to drop you off before heading into work.”

She nodded as they went their separate ways, course list in hand. Her class load as a sophomore was going to be busy enough on top of her new principal dancer role in the college ballet company. But it was nothing to compared to Max who was determined to prove that one could study and work fulltime at the same time.

There must be something to waking up at the crack of dawn, she thought with a shudder. Not that she had any direct experience as she loved sleeping in. There was nothing quite like it and no one could ever convince her otherwise.

Lost in thought, she reached for a copy of the comparative literature textbook only to pause when someone’s hand half closed over hers, electricity sparking where skin met skin. Startled, she glanced sideways and then up to see another student watching her intently, both of them keeping their hands locked on the book.

He was tall, easily six feet two she guessed, with dark brown hair that was slightly messy as if he’d run his fingers through it in frustration. The light stubble on his jaw highlighted his full lips currently twisted in a smirk that made him far too appealing by her measure. But it was his laser blue eyes that made her heart skip a beat. She could lose herself in them.

“Excuse me,” his deep voice rumbled, hand tightening around the book.

Cassie shook herself to clear the fog in her head. She regarded him and then the book on the shelf they had both tried to grab. It was the last copy. Apparently, the professor’s reputation for easy grading had resulted in high enrollment.

“I was here first,” she said, arching one eyebrow, not letting him see how much he affected her.

“That’s debatable,” he argued. “Anyone can clearly see from the position of our hands that I reached for it first.”

Cassie scoffed at that. “Look again, Sherlock. Your hand is above mine, ergo, the book is mine.”

His thick brows snapped together in annoyance when she refused to back down.

She tried to pull the book off the shelf, only to have him tug it too. They were standing in the narrow aisle caught in a tug of war, Cassie standing on her toes to get in his face, green eyes narrowed, when Max walked over and plucked the book out of their hands.

“Hey!” they both turned, standing side by side, arms akimbo and temporarily united in their displeasure.

“The two of you are making a scene,” said Max, nodding over their shoulders to point at the students gathered at the other end of the aisle watching them and whispering.

“He’s trying to steal my book!” grumbled Cassie, folding her arms defiantly across her chest.

“I’m not stealing anything,” the other student said exasperated. “You just cannot accept that I got to it first. Maybe if you weren’t daydreaming, you’d have noticed.”

Cassie opened her mouth to protest but shut it when Max raised his hand for silence.

“Let me get this straight,” he began scanning the textbook cover “you’re both taking comparative literature this semester and there is only copy left. You both think you reached for it first and now you’re standing in the aisle arguing about it.”

“I don’t think I reached for it first, I know…” said the student recalcitrant, quieting down as if realizing how petulant he sounded.

“Look…” paused Max, looking at the other man in question.

“Ethan,” he said, shoving his hands into the pocket of his jacket.

“Look, Ethan, why don’t you and my sister just share the book until the bookstore gets more copies?” said Max reasonably. “You’re both in the same class, so it’s not like you won’t be stuck together for the next few months. Cassie?”

Cassie rolled her eyes at Max’s conciliatory tone. If there was one thing that he excelled at it was finding a compromise. She wasn’t in the mood for it, but she knew from the expression on his face that she didn’t have much of a choice.

“Fine,” she said ungraciously. “I will if he will.”

“Alright,” said Ethan, unbending enough to bow his head in acknowledgment. “But who pays for it?”

In the end, they split the cost fifty-fifty and exchanged phone numbers to arrange next steps. Ethan walked over with her and Max to the parking lot, his steps hesitant as if unsure of what he was doing.

Cassie watched him out of the corner of her eyes, looking away quickly in case he caught her staring and missing the fact that he was doing the same to her.

As the car drove away, Ethan Ramsey stood in the parking lot watching the headlights disappear. He thought he saw Cassie turn in her seat to look back at him, but maybe that was just wishful thinking.

He didn’t know what he was doing here; they’d already exchanged phone numbers and should have parted ways after completing their purchase at the bookstore. And yet, he found himself engaging in conversation with Max, who appeared to be a more reasonable person than his sister given how successfully he’d negotiated a truce. But it hadn’t been his company Ethan craved.

He’d been standing inside the bookstore entrance scanning his textbook list and had noticed her as soon as she walked in. Her blonde hair falling loose around her shoulders, the sundress she wore hugging her curves and making him salivate. He wasn’t a creepy voyeur and forced himself to look away, walking in the opposite direction and away from temptation.

Later, he couldn’t believe his luck when they’d both clashed over a textbook. Up close, he couldn’t help but notice how her green eyes sparkled or the way her lips pouted in a way that made him want to capture them in a searing kiss. He wondered if she’d felt the spark when their hands connected over the book.

From the first moment, he’d felt…drawn to Cassie Valentine. He couldn’t find another word to describe it.

He shouldn’t be feeling anything for anyone right now. He needed to focus on his studies and keep his grades up for the sake of his scholarship but also because he needed them to get into Johns Hopkins School of Medicine. That was the end goal; he couldn’t afford any distractions.

And she would be a major distraction. He could feel it in his bones.

Tobias lowered his eyes and stumbled. He had spent a lifetime procuring a sense of who he was, and, as much as Casey meant to him, she had never fit into the picture of the life he envisioned for himself. He thought they could have sustained as they were… but now… he couldn’t even define what they had been, and Sienna was right. Casey deserved so much more.  
With a deep breath, he stood tall and wordlessly walked away.
“Where are you going?” Sienna demanded.
“Don’t worry, Si. I know exactly what I need to do.”

Sienna may have been stealthy, but her tiny legs couldn’t beat him, and the last thing she wanted to do was bring more attention their way.

“Come in,” Casey’s voice hollered from behind the door.

Her face turned pale when she saw Tobias enter, with Sienna following in quick succession. A multitude of emotions coursed over her in a matter of seconds. The first of which was anger for feeling her spirits spontaneously rise at the very sight of him. Why did she have to care for him so much! More than she ever let on, even to herself. But the time for such admissions was in the past. Whatever they had been to each other, it was over now. She told him that, and she meant it. So, why did she want nothing more than to fall into his arms? And why did her stomach clench, and bitter tears sting at her eyes when she reminded herself that would never happen again?

Sienna was breathless. “I’m so sorry, Casey,” she breathed, staring daggers at the man as she rushed to her friend’s side. “I tried to stop him.”

"It’s OK, Si,” Casey replied softly. “I suppose we’re going to have to talk at some point. I may as well get it over with.”

“You don’t have to,” Sienna insisted. “And you certainly don’t have to right now. Just say the word, and I’ll call….”

Casey squeezed her friend’s hand, stopping her words as she spoke.  

“Seriously. I’ll be fine. I promise.”

“Only, If you’re sure.”

“I am.”

Acquiescing, Sienna began to back her way out of the room. “Fine,” she spat before turning to Tobias with a stern glare and a pointed finger. “But I will be watching you!”

Without taking his eyes off Casey, he raised his hands. “I’d expect no less.”

Sienna closed the door with a final look, leaving the two alone. Casey’s eyes lingered on Tobias’s for a split second before she hastily turned them away. She peered out the window, and the bright sun forced her puffy, red eyes shut. 

“Why are you here?” she asked, her voice no more than a whisper. “You don’t need to be.”

“Did it ever occur to you that I want to be?”

She turned toward him defiantly. “Why, Tobias? I was never really yours to begin with. And I already told you I had a miscarriage. Your responsibility in all of this is all over. There is nothing that binds us anymore.”

“Well, I’m sorry you feel that way, Casey, but I don’t agree. I don’t agree with that at all.”  

He motioned to a chair alongside her bed, slipping into it the moment that she nodded.    

“What happened?” he asked. “Why were you admitted.”

“It’s precautionary. When I got home last night, I spiked a fever and started vomiting. It doesn’t seem to be related, but they kept me overnight for observation in light of the circumstances. I’ll be leaving today.”

“How do you feel now?”

“Physically? Outside of being exhausted, I’m fine.”

“And… other than physically?” he asked nervously.

Casey shifted in the bed and shrugged. “I guess I have no right to be sad about losing things that were never mine to begin with. Do I?”

“Yes,” he answered empathetically. “You do. You have the right to be sad about anything you want, and if it helps, I’m sad too.”

Her head sprung up, and she looked at him with shock. “You… you are?”

“Yes.”

“Why?” she asked with a cracked voice.

Tobias sighed loudly before sinking back into his seat, rubbing his hands over his face with frustration. “Where to even start?” he moaned. “There are so many reasons, and I hate how much I’ve hurt you.”

“You didn’t hurt me,” she lied.

“I did,” he declared. “I didn’t mean to. I didn’t want to, but I did.”

His head dropped into his hands, pausing for a moment in an attempt to regain his composure before he continued.  

“I know we never… I never… defined what we were. So, it’s easy to assume that you didn’t mean much to me. But that’s not true, that’s not true at all.”

“Whenever I asked you,” she hesitated, “whenever I asked you if you wanted to be more… you….”

“I told you I didn’t believe in labels. That what we had was good, so why ruin it.”

“Yeah,” she smiled sadly while tugging at the trim on her hospital gown, “that’s what you’d say.”

“But the thing is, it wasn’tgood.”

“It wasn’t?” She gasped, her wide eyes meeting his in horror.

“No, no, not like that,” he reassured, eager to take her hand but aware he should not cross that line. “It was good. It was wonderful… forme. But I always knew that you wanted more, and I thought I was doing the right thing because I was being honest with you. But now I can see that I wasn’t being fair.”  

Casey leaned back into her pillow, and her body trembled as she let out a shuddering sigh. She looked up at the ceiling before she replied. “No, you weren’t. But you aren’t the only one at fault. I was never fully honest, either. At first, I convinced myself that it didn’t matter. Because it was new, we didn’t really know where it was heading. So I thought it would be silly to bring it up. But, once I realized I wanted more, I also realized that asking for it could mean losing you all together, so I stayed quiet. I was wrong. I should have been candid, and if we weren’t on the same page, we’d each have a choice to make. But I wanted to keep you around so much that I lied to myself. I let myself believe that we were something that we weren’t. And that’s not on you.” 

“Who says we weren’t?” He lamented as he reached for her retreating hand. He looked up, and when their eyes met, she returned her hand to the place it was before, allowing him to take it gently in his.

“I never wanted to settle down. I never wanted to be tied to just one person…” he admitted, “but… I haven’t been with anyone else since I’ve been with you… not once.”

“You.. you haven’t?” she asked with a scrunched brow.

“No!” He answered emphatically. “I never wanted to be. I mean, I was almost always with you… did you think….”

“We weren’t always together. We worked different shifts, we had separate homes, some different friends… we weren’t always together, Tobias. And how was I to know?”

“I’d like to say that I didn’t let you know because I didn’t think you cared, but I knew you did. I knew. I should never have left you wondering.”

“Did you… did you ever think that I was with… did you care if I was with anyone else? I wasn’t, she clarified, “but would you have cared?”

“Of course, I would have! I just didn’t let my mind go there, especially since I had no right to tell you what to do.”

They looked away from each other as the room fell silent.  

“I’d see you flirting,” she said sheepishly. “It hurt sometimes, but I wasn’t… I wasn’t  your girlfriend… and it never went so far that….” She tapered.

“It never went far at all, Casey. That’s just who I am. I’d flirt with that doorknob if I could. But I don’t mean anything by it. Half that time, I’m just trying to make the other person feel seen. You know?”  

“I guess,” she said with a wave of her hand before correcting. “No, I didn’t. I didn’t know.”

“Then I’m sorry,”  he muttered, caressing her hand in his. “I’ll never forgive myself for hurting you that way.”

“Tobias,” she cried, taking her hand back to wipe the tears beginning to trickle from her eyes. “When I saw you, with Stephanie, last night… I ….”

“I know… I know…” he fretted, “but I was only playing pool, I wasn’t….”

“Butshe was!”  Casey interrupted. “She was making a play for you. It was obvious. And, from what I could see, you weren’t stopping her.”

“You’re right. I was wrong. I guess my damn ego took over, but I swear, I had no desire to… I am so, so sorry for hurting you, Casey. Especially after all you had been through.”

“You didn’t know,” she sighed, her demeanor softening.  

“It doesn’t matter. I shouldn’t have behaved that way regardless.”

Casey took a tissue from the box on her end table. “Tobias?” she sniffled.

“Yes.”

“How would you have reacted if… if I hadn’t miscarried? If I was still pregnant now.”

“I can’t honestly say,” his voice trembled. “It was so unexpected, and that’s such a big thing… I can’t say. But I can assure you, we would have gotten through it together, and I would have been by your side. I hope you know I would have been there with you, every step of the way, no matter what you decided.”

“I do know that,” she cried.

“When you told me last night, and for a brief moment, I thought you were pregnant… after a second of abject fear, the only thing I felt was this instinctive desire to protect you. I wish I could have been with you, Casey,” he blubbered as his head fell into her lap. “You shouldn’t have had to go through what you did alone.”

“I know,” she cried. “And I shave told you straight away. I’m sorry too. But I suppose there is nothing we can do about that now.”

“What about you,” he asked. “What about you? How would you have reacted if… if things had turned out differently.”

“I don’t know. I’ve always wanted to be a mother one day. Not while I’m a resident,” she chuckled sadly. “And now with someone who didn’t want…” she stopped as her voice caught in her throat. “But … one day. I certainly wasn’t ready now, but if I would have had to….”

“You would have, and better than you could imagine,” he smiled.

“I’m sorry,” she whispered.

“Hey, you have nothing to apologize for. I should have made it clear how much I felt for you sooner. You weren’t with someone who didn’t want you, Casey. I did.I do.” He looked at her and brushed a strand of hair from her eyes. “Can we work through this, Casey? I don’t want to lose you.”

She squirmed uncomfortably, her eyes filled with tears.  

“But has anything changed? Do we want the same things from life? And now there is so much water under the bridge.”

“I’d like to try,” he pleaded. “Will you give me a chance?”

As the emotion of the past day began to take over, Casey broke down.  

“I don’t know, she sobbed. “I just don’t know. I wish we could meet for the first time all over again. I just feel so lost right now. I don’t know what to think right now. I need some time.”

She thought her heart couldn’t have felt any more broken, but she was proven wrong when she saw the sadness in his eyes.

“If that’s what you want,” he whispered.

“It is.”

Unable to look at him, she turned to the clock. “You should go,” she insisted. “You should go. I’ve barely slept, and I probably only have a few more hours in this swank joint.” She attempted a smile. “I should try to get some sleep.”

“Are you sure? I don’t mind staying. I can watch over you while you sleep.”

“There is no need. I’m sure you haven’t slept either, and you should,” she said, running her hand over the back of his head. “Thank you for coming, Tobias.”

“You don’t have to thank me. There was no place else I wanted to be.”

He stood up, doing his best not to falter as he came to his feet.  

“I’m sorry I realized things too late,” he said as he kissed her forehead. “If you ever want me… need me, you know where to find me. I’ll be there.”

“I know,” she gasped, swallowing back tears. “I do. Goodbye, Tobias.”

He silently walked to the door, turning to look at her with a crooked smile before he walking away. And then he was gone, and Casey broke down in tears. Clutching her pillow close to her chest, her body trembled as it was overcome with pain. She wanted him, and she needed him. Why did she tell him to leave? She tossed her legs over the side of her bed, determined to go after him. But dizziness overtook her as she rose to her feet, causing the room to spin. She grasped the side of the bed to steady, berating herself for being so foolish. She had no choice now, she let him go.

Tobias dashed down the hallway, afraid that if he didn’t leave quickly, he would not be able to give her the space that she needed. Not with every fiber in his being fighting to return to her side, hold her close, and convince her to give them another chance. Her words echoed in his mind.  

I just don’t know. I wish we could meet for the first time all over again.

He pushed the door open with all his might.

“Whoa,” he yelled, his eyes filled with fright. “What are you doing? Are you OK?”

“I’m just dizzy,” Casey replied.

“Well, let’s get you back into bed. Why were you getting up anyway?”

Safely seated again, Casey nervously nibbeld at her lip when she turned up to him.  

“I wanted to go get you, because….”

“No,” he said, placing a finger over her lips. “Before you continue…” he sat in the chair and extended his hand.

“Good morning. I’m Dr. Tobias Carrick. And you are?”

A sheepish grin spread on Casey’s pretty face.  

“I’m Dr. Casey MacTavish,” she smiled.  

“A doctor,” he sang as he looked her over. “They always say doctors make the worst patients. I think you’re lucky that I stumbled in here when I did Dr. MacTavish.”

“You’re probably right,” she laughed. “It’s very nice to meet you.”

“Trust me,” he winked, “the pleasure is all mine. I looked at your chart, and it says you’re heading home today. Do you have someone picking you up?”

“Yes, my roommates… my friends are. They’ll get me home safely.”

“Good. Good. And, obviously, you’ll need some rest, but when you’re up to it… would you be interested in going on a date?”

“A date?” she exclaimed.

“Yes,” he beamed, “a proper date. Where you are treated like the treasure that you are. Where it is very clear that you’re on my arm, and that’s where I want you to be. Would you like that?”

“That would be nice,” she smiled, “but… why don’t you come to my place tonight. I could use some company and, maybe, someone to hold on to.”

“I can do that,” he asserted.

“You can?” Casey teased.

“Absolutely, I can. On one condition.”

“And what is that?” she smirked.

“I still get to take you on a proper date when you feel better,” he smiled, taking her hand.

“Oh, you just try to get out of it!” she beamed.  

Tobias sat on the edge of the bed next to Casey, placing his arm gently around her shoulder.  

“I this a new beginning?” he asked.  

Casey gazed up at him with a sparkle in her eyes he had never seen before.

“It is,” she gushed. “It is.”

“Good,” he grinned, “because, this time, I know exactly what I want.”

“Oh,” she said as he lowered his lips toward hers. “And what’s that?”

“It’s you.”
